Thank you for choosing a Hasselblad XPan II. This camera incorporates an innovative dual format
facility providing a 24x65 mm format - full panorama - as well as a conventional 24x36 mm
format on the same film. This means you can have all the convenience and advantages of the 35
mm format but can produce an image with one side wider than the 6x6 cm format. Put simply
- medium-format panorama quality from a 35 mm camera while still providing the option of
the conventional format!

The Hasselblad XPan II is a feature-packed and highly professional tool. It includes both auto-
matic facilities and total manual override for complete control to suit all situations and working
methods. Auto exposure, auto bracketing, coupled rangefinder and pre-wind are just some of the
advantageous features.
